Online Provider’s Takeover Rumours 

16 January 2008

According to numerous reports out this week, Playtech is close to sealing a deal that will see it purchase UK online bingo provider Virtue Fusion.

Although spokesmen from both companies have refused to comment and it is not known how much this deal could be worth, these rumours follow a statement from online software provider Playtech last week that it was to pursue an aggressive acquisition strategy.

Virtue Fusion provides the back-end for Rank's Mecca online bingo operation along with William Hill and Bet365 and any deal would see its products conflict with the bingo product Playtech already offers in tandem with its poker, casino, mobile and live-dealer products.

Playtech’s last major online acquisition was the takeover of Tribeca Tables, which brought a significant number of online poker sites into its fold following the passage of America’s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act (UIGEA) in late 2006. This deal was worth $75,000 and included the transition of poker operations for sites such as Paddy Power Poker, VC Poker and Blue Square’s poker operation to the iPoker network.
